Overnight closures during June 2026

Overnight closures will be taking place on the A46 between Billesley Crossroads and Bishopton Roundabout over 15 nights between 8 and 26 June.

Our appointed highways contractor, Montel Civil Engineering, is now approaching the final phase of construction for the access roundabout which connects the A46, Drayton Manor Drive and the new internal access road.

To allow the roundabout to be completed, Montel has scheduled a programme of overnight road closures which will take place between 8.00pm to 6.00am over fifteen nights between Monday 8 to Friday 26 June 2026. Please note that these dates and timings remain subject to change.

For residents and businesses located along the section of road that will be closed, including Drayton Manor Drive and Bannatyne Health Club, the schedule of arrangements for access and egress during the overnight closures can be viewed on Montel’s website. Please note that Montel’s schedule is indicative and may be subject to change as the works progress.

The official diversion route will follow the same route used during the previous programme of overnight closures in February 2026 and will redirect through traffic via the A435 and A4189 during the main A46 closure. Montel will install extensive signage to indicate the official diversion route. A copy of the diversion route can also be viewed on Montel’s website via the link above.

The main works will take place during the first fortnight of overnight closures and the final four nights of closures during week commencing on 23, 24, 25 and 26 June have been scheduled to allow contingency for National Highways to complete their statutory safety audit to sign off the scheme.

For residents and local traffic entering or exiting the section of road closed overnight, limited access will be permitted. To view a map of the full diversion route and for more details, please visit Montel’s dedicated scheme website.

We would like to thank the community in advance for their understanding during the upcoming closures and we have sought to minimise disruption where possible by closing the A46 at quieter periods overnight.

Since the start of construction in September 2025, we have been working to deliver the new access roundabout on the A46 and internal road infrastructure alongside work to survey, connect and divert utilities.

We anticipate that work to construct the new access roundabout which connects Drayton Manor Drive, the A46 and the new internal access road will be completed in Summer 2026 following the next series of planned overnight closures on the A46 between Monday 8 and Friday 26 June.

Our work to deliver on site infrastructure including earthworks, landscaping and the new internal access roads will continue during 2026. Construction of the first buildings is anticipated to start in late 2026.
